CrowdStrike's integration of Opus 4.7 into its Falcon® platform represents a significant leap forward in artificial intelligence (AI) applications within cybersecurity. This advanced Frontier AI model is now operational across the Falcon Platform, enhancing the company's ability to detect and remediate vulnerabilities efficiently. By leveraging Opus 4.7, CrowdStrike has not only accelerated real-time vulnerability discovery but also improved the accuracy of threat detection, enabling faster response times and more precise remediation efforts. This integration underscores CrowdStrike's commitment to transforming cybersecurity through AI-driven solutions, offering enterprises a powerful toolset to safeguard their infrastructure against evolving threats.

In addition to this integration, CrowdStrike has partnered with Project QuiltWorks, further amplifying the platform's AI capabilities through Falcon Exposure Management, Charlotte Agentic SOAR, and Charlotte AI AgentWorks. These tools collectively enhance the Falcon Platform's AI readiness and secure AI adoption across enterprises. Falcon Exposure Management enables real-time monitoring of exposed endpoints, helping organizations identify potential risks before they escalate. Charlotte Agentic SOAR provides a unified command-and-control interface for incident response teams, ensuring seamless coordination across disparate systems. Meanwhile, Charlotte AI AgentWorks automates remediation processes, reducing the need for manual intervention and minimizing human error. Together, these initiatives create a comprehensive security ecosystem that empowers enterprises to adopt AI-driven threat management with confidence.

Simultaneously, Claude Security has launched its security tool in public beta, offering a robust solution for codebase scanning, validation, and patch suggestions post-validation. This tool is designed to eliminate false positives and provide actionable insights for user approval processes, making it an invaluable asset for enterprises seeking to enhance their cybersecurity posture. By focusing on targeted threat detection and mitigation strategies, Claude Security complements CrowdStrike's efforts in the AI-driven security space, offering a unique approach that empowers organizations to stay ahead of evolving threats.
